Not legal advice. up: https://georgiacommons.org/code/21-2.md previous: https://georgiacommons.org/code/21-2-191.md next: https://georgiacommons.org/code/21-2-193.md index: https://georgiacommons.org/code/index.md version: the only printed version in_force: true current_through: Including Acts of the 2025 Regular Session of the General Assembly heading_path: ELECTIONS / ELECTIONS AND PRIMARIES GENERALLY / PRESIDENTIAL PREFERENCE PRIMARY --- # O.C.G.A. § 21-2-192. Proclamation by Governor; copies of proclamation transmitted to superintendents. It shall be the duty of the Governor to issue his proclamation for such presidential preference primary, a copy of which shall be transmitted promptly by the Secretary of State to the superintendent of each county. ## History Code 1933, § 34-1008A, enacted by Ga. L. 1973, p. 221, § 1; Ga. L. 1975, p. 1223, § 3; Ga. L. 1986, p. 220, § 2.
